Wat beteken geval wanneer beteken in SQL?
Wat beteken geval wanneer beteken in SQL?

Video: Wat beteken geval wanneer beteken in SQL?

Video: Wat beteken geval wanneer beteken in SQL?
Video: Hoe werkt SQL? Introductie Webinar 2024, April
Anonim

Die SQL CASE-verklaring

Die CASE-verklaring gaan deur toestande en gee 'n waarde terug wanneer die eerste toestand voldoen word (soos 'n IF- DAN-ANDERS stelling ). Dus, een keer a toestand waar is, sal dit ophou lees en die resultaat gee. As geen voorwaardes waar is nie, gee dit die waarde in die ELSE-klousule.

Vervolgens kan mens ook vra, hoe skryf jy 'n gevalstelling in SQL?

Die CASE-verklaring kan gebruik word in SQL Bediener (transaksie- SQL ). KIES kontak_id, GEVAL WHEN website_id = 1 DAN 'TechOnTheNet.com' WANNEER website_id = 2 DAN 'CheckYourMath.com' ANDERS 'BigActivities.com' EINDIG VAN kontakte; Een ding om daarop te let is dat die ELSE toestand binne die CASE-verklaring is opsioneel.

wat is geval en dekodeer in SQL? Verskil tussen CASE en DeKODE is.:- GEVAL is 'n stelling waar as DEKODEER is 'n funksie.:- GEVAL kan in beide gebruik word SQL en PLSQL. Maar DEKODEER kan slegs gebruik word in SQL .:- GEVAL word gebruik in waar klousule Maar jy kan nie gebruik nie DEKODEER in waar klousule.

Die vraag is ook, wat doen 'n saakverklaring?

GEVAL Verklaring . Die CASE-verklaring kies uit 'n reeks voorwaardes, en voer 'n ooreenstemmende uit verklaring . Die CASE-verklaring evalueer 'n enkeling uitdrukking en vergelyk dit met verskeie potensiële waardes, of evalueer veelvuldige Boole-uitdrukkings en kies die eerste een wat WAAR is.

KAN JY IF-stellings in SQL DOEN?

In MS SQL , IF … ANDERS is 'n tipe van Voorwaardelike verklaring . Enige T- SQL-stelling kan voorwaardelik uitgevoer word met behulp van IF … ANDERS . As die toestand evalueer na Waar, dan T- SQL-stellings gevolg deur IF sleutelwoord sal tereggestel word.

Aanbeveel: